#318435 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#318435 is composed of 19.2% red, 51.8% green and 20.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 62.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 59.8% yellow and 48.2% black. It has a hue angle of 122.9 degrees, a saturation of 45.9% and a lightness of 35.5%. #318435 color hex could be obtained by blending #62ff6a with #000900. Closest websafe color is: #339933.

#318435 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#318435 has RGB values of R:49, G:132, B:53 and CMYK values of C:0.63, M:0, Y:0.6, K:0.48. Its decimal value is 3245109.
